Paradise - Review - Capitol Hill - Seattle - The Infatuation

"A new Mexican restaurant has opened in the former Olmstead location on Capitol Hill. It has an all-day diner-style menu, which means if you're hungry for bananas foster french toast, linguine bolognese, and asada nachos all at once, they’ve got it. We haven’t been here yet, but want you to know this spot exists." - Kayla Sager-Riley

Art of the Table in Seattle Announces Long Goodbye Closing Plan | Eater Seattle

"A new spot in Capitol Hill is open but currently has no web presence or menu; it is testing out dishes like burritos and burgers to see what diners prefer. Operating like a diner, it is open for breakfast, lunch, and dinner, and occupies the space formerly used by Broadway Grill. Note that it does not yet have its liquor license, so come with the correct expectations." - Courtney E. Smith
